Christine received her Bachelor of Arts in French Literature and Language from the American University of Paris, France, and an MBA from the University of Denver’s Daniels College of Business. After many happy years working within the apparel industry, both domestically and overseas, she decided to change direction and earned her Master’s of Arts in Professional Counseling from the University of Missouri at Kansas City. Her goal is to help clients face and overcome various life challenges, providing psycho-education to gain a deeper understanding of one’s mental and emotional processes, but also help clients develop and build various intervention techniques that bolster and foster increased self-awareness, frustration tolerance, and the ability to manage one’s thoughts and feelings that lead to greater life satisfaction. She strives to do all this within a welcoming, safe, healing, supportive, and encouraging environment.
